I have an American Strat and I lost the original Allen key for the bridge. The saddles in my bridge were so small, I couldn't find another key to work. I tried finding the smallest key possible in hardware stores and even had to file down a key. Finally I gave up and added it to my thomann basket. Fits perfectly, simple as that!

I recently bought some new Fender saddles for my Strat, so I needed this for the setup. It certainly did the job, and although Fender designed an unnecessarily small gauge, (0.05") it has done quite a few adjustments since purchase without any noticeable wear. Therefore, I would judge it to be a well-machined tool, made from good material. The downside is the price, I think it's shockingly expensive for a hex key!
